Has anyone upgraded to ESXi 5? it'll be great to understand your experience good and bad?

Personally I didn't upgraded my servers to ESXi5 but browsing community you can find posts with problems described by users during upgrade. As Troy says, ESXi is for quite a long time, if you don't have specific agents or other third party tools installed on your ESX, you can migrate to ESXi without issues (of course your HW has to be on HCL list Smiley Wink)

I have plans to upgrade my production servers when VMware release Update 1 for vSphere5.

BTW. you can have mixed ESX and ESXi in on cluster so you can give a try with ESXi on one or two hosts
